What’s Involved in Infidelity Surveillance?
Our infidelity investigations include surveillance, GPS tracking (when legal), photographic evidence, social media analysis, and background checks to verify behaviors and relationships. Every case is handled with complete discretion and legal compliance. You’ll receive court-ready reports, timestamps, and video/photo documentation to support your next steps—whether personal or legal.
